/* vi: set sw=4 ts=4: */
/*
* Mini cpio implementation for busybox
*
* Copyright (C) 2001 by Glenn McGrath
*
* Licensed under GPLv2 or later, see file LICENSE in this source tree.
*
* Limitations:
* Doesn't check CRC's
* Only supports new ASCII and CRC formats
*/
#include "libbb.h"
#include "common_bufsiz.h"
#include "bb_archive.h"
//config:config CPIO
//config: bool "cpio"
//config: default y
//config: help
//config: cpio is an archival utility program used to create, modify, and
//config: extract contents from archives.
//config: cpio has 110 bytes of overheads for every stored file.
//config:
//config: This implementation of cpio can extract cpio archives created in the
//config: "newc" or "crc" format.
//config:
//config: Unless you have a specific application which requires cpio, you
//config: should probably say N here.
//config:
//config:config FEATURE_CPIO_O
//config: bool "Support archive creation"
//config: default y
//config: depends on CPIO
//config: help
//config: This implementation of cpio can create cpio archives in the "newc"
//config: format only.
//config:
//config:config FEATURE_CPIO_P
//config: bool "Support passthrough mode"
//config: default y
//config: depends on FEATURE_CPIO_O
//config: help
//config: Passthrough mode. Rarely used.
//applet:IF_CPIO(APPLET(cpio, BB_DIR_BIN, BB_SUID_DROP))
//kbuild:lib-$(CONFIG_CPIO) += cpio.o
//usage:#define cpio_trivial_usage
//usage: "[-dmvu] [-F FILE] [-R USER[:GRP]]" IF_FEATURE_CPIO_O(" [-H newc]")
//usage: " [-ti"IF_FEATURE_CPIO_O("o")"]" IF_FEATURE_CPIO_P(" [-p DIR]")
//usage: " [EXTR_FILE]..."
//usage:#define cpio_full_usage "\n\n"
//usage: "Extract (-i) or list (-t) files from a cpio archive"
//usage: IF_FEATURE_CPIO_O(", or"
//usage: "\ntake file list from stdin and create an archive (-o)"
//usage: IF_FEATURE_CPIO_P(" or copy files (-p)")
//usage: )
//usage: "\n"
//usage: "\nMain operation mode:"
//usage: "\n -t List"
//usage: "\n -i Extract EXTR_FILEs (or all)"
//usage: IF_FEATURE_CPIO_O(
//usage: "\n -o Create (requires -H newc)"
//usage: )
//usage: IF_FEATURE_CPIO_P(
//usage: "\n -p DIR Copy files to DIR"
//usage: )
//usage: "\nOptions:"
//usage: "\n -d Make leading directories"
//usage: "\n -m Preserve mtime"
//usage: "\n -v Verbose"
//usage: "\n -u Overwrite"
//usage: "\n -F FILE Input (-t,-i,-p) or output (-o) file"
//usage: "\n -R USER[:GRP] Set owner of created files"
//usage: IF_FEATURE_CPIO_O(
//usage: "\n -H newc Archive format"
//usage: )
/* GNU cpio 2.9 --help (abridged):
Modes:
-t, --list List the archive
-i, --extract Extract files from an archive
-o, --create Create the archive
-p, --pass-through Copy-pass mode
Options valid in any mode:
--block-size=SIZE I/O block size = SIZE * 512 bytes
-B I/O block size = 5120 bytes
-c Use the old portable (ASCII) archive format
-C, --io-size=NUMBER I/O block size in bytes
-f, --nonmatching Only copy files that do not match given pattern
-F, --file=FILE Use FILE instead of standard input or output
-H, --format=FORMAT Use given archive FORMAT
-M, --message=STRING Print STRING when the end of a volume of the
backup media is reached
-n, --numeric-uid-gid If -v, show numeric UID and GID
--quiet Do not print the number of blocks copied
--rsh-command=COMMAND Use remote COMMAND instead of rsh
-v, --verbose Verbosely list the files processed
-V, --dot Print a "." for each file processed
-W, --warning=FLAG Control warning display: 'none','truncate','all';
multiple options accumulate
Options valid only in --extract mode:
-b, --swap Swap both halfwords of words and bytes of
halfwords in the data (equivalent to -sS)
-r, --rename Interactively rename files
-s, --swap-bytes Swap the bytes of each halfword in the files
-S, --swap-halfwords Swap the halfwords of each word (4 bytes)
--to-stdout Extract files to standard output
-E, --pattern-file=FILE Read additional patterns specifying filenames to
extract or list from FILE
--only-verify-crc Verify CRC's, don't actually extract the files
Options valid only in --create mode:
-A, --append Append to an existing archive
-O FILE File to use instead of standard output
Options valid only in --pass-through mode:
-l, --link Link files instead of copying them, when possible
Options valid in --extract and --create modes:
--absolute-filenames Do not strip file system prefix components from
the file names
--no-absolute-filenames Create all files relative to the current dir
Options valid in --create and --pass-through modes:
-0, --null A list of filenames is terminated by a NUL
-a, --reset-access-time Reset the access times of files after reading them
-I FILE File to use instead of standard input
-L, --dereference Dereference symbolic links (copy the files
that they point to instead of copying the links)
-R, --owner=[USER][:.][GRP] Set owner of created files
Options valid in --extract and --pass-through modes:
-d, --make-directories Create leading directories where needed
-m, --preserve-modification-time Retain mtime when creating files
--no-preserve-owner Do not change the ownership of the files
--sparse Write files with blocks of zeros as sparse files
-u, --unconditional Replace all files unconditionally
*/

#if ENABLE_FEATURE_CPIO_O
static off_t cpio_pad4(off_t size)
{
int i;
i = (- size) & 3;
size += i;
while (--i >= 0)
bb_putchar('\0');
return size;
}
/* Return value will become exit code.
* It's ok to exit instead of return. */
static NOINLINE int cpio_o(void)
{
struct name_s {
struct name_s *next;
char name[1];
};
struct inodes_s {
struct inodes_s *next;
struct name_s *names;
struct stat st;
};
struct inodes_s *links = NULL;
off_t bytes = 0; /* output bytes count */
while (1) {
const char *name;
char *line;
struct stat st;
line = (option_mask32 & OPT_NUL_TERMINATED)
? bb_get_chunk_from_file(stdin, NULL)
: xmalloc_fgetline(stdin);
if (line) {
/* Strip leading "./[./]..." from the filename */
name = line;
while (name[0] == '.' && name[1] == '/') {
while (*++name == '/')
continue;
}
if (!*name) { /* line is empty */
free(line);
continue;
}
if ((option_mask32 & OPT_DEREF)
? stat(name, &st)
: lstat(name, &st)
) {
abort_cpio_o:
bb_simple_perror_msg_and_die(name);
}
if (G.owner_ugid.uid != (uid_t)-1L)
st.st_uid = G.owner_ugid.uid;
if (G.owner_ugid.gid != (gid_t)-1L)
st.st_gid = G.owner_ugid.gid;
if (!(S_ISLNK(st.st_mode) || S_ISREG(st.st_mode)))
st.st_size = 0; /* paranoia */
/* Store hardlinks for later processing, dont output them */
if (!S_ISDIR(st.st_mode) && st.st_nlink > 1) {
struct name_s *n;
struct inodes_s *l;
/* Do we have this hardlink remembered? */
l = links;
while (1) {
if (l == NULL) {
/* Not found: add new item to "links" list */
l = xzalloc(sizeof(*l));
l->st = st;
l->next = links;
links = l;
break;
}
if (l->st.st_ino == st.st_ino) {
/* found */
break;
}
l = l->next;
}
/* Add new name to "l->names" list */
n = xmalloc(sizeof(*n) + strlen(name));
strcpy(n->name, name);
n->next = l->names;
l->names = n;
free(line);
continue;
}
} else { /* line == NULL: EOF */
next_link:
if (links) {
/* Output hardlink's data */
st = links->st;
name = links->names->name;
links->names = links->names->next;
/* GNU cpio is reported to emit file data
* only for the last instance. Mimic that. */
if (links->names == NULL)
links = links->next;
else
st.st_size = 0;
/* NB: we leak links->names and/or links,
* this is intended (we exit soon anyway) */
} else {
/* If no (more) hardlinks to output,
* output "trailer" entry */
name = cpio_TRAILER;
/* st.st_size == 0 is a must, but for uniformity
* in the output, we zero out everything */
memset(&st, 0, sizeof(st));
/* st.st_nlink = 1; - GNU cpio does this */
}
}
bytes += printf("070701"
"%08X%08X%08X%08X%08X%08X%08X"
"%08X%08X%08X%08X" /* GNU cpio uses uppercase hex */
/* strlen+1: */ "%08X"
/* chksum: */ "00000000" /* (only for "070702" files) */
/* name,NUL: */ "%s%c",
(unsigned)(uint32_t) st.st_ino,
(unsigned)(uint32_t) st.st_mode,
(unsigned)(uint32_t) st.st_uid,
(unsigned)(uint32_t) st.st_gid,
(unsigned)(uint32_t) st.st_nlink,
(unsigned)(uint32_t) st.st_mtime,
(unsigned)(uint32_t) st.st_size,
(unsigned)(uint32_t) major(st.st_dev),
(unsigned)(uint32_t) minor(st.st_dev),
(unsigned)(uint32_t) major(st.st_rdev),
(unsigned)(uint32_t) minor(st.st_rdev),
(unsigned)(strlen(name) + 1),
name, '\0');
bytes = cpio_pad4(bytes);
if (st.st_size) {
if (S_ISLNK(st.st_mode)) {
char *lpath = xmalloc_readlink_or_warn(name);
if (!lpath)
goto abort_cpio_o;
bytes += printf("%s", lpath);
free(lpath);
} else { /* S_ISREG */
int fd = xopen(name, O_RDONLY);
fflush_all();
/* We must abort if file got shorter too! */
bb_copyfd_exact_size(fd, STDOUT_FILENO, st.st_size);
bytes += st.st_size;
close(fd);
}
bytes = cpio_pad4(bytes);
}
if (!line) {
if (name != cpio_TRAILER)
goto next_link;
/* TODO: GNU cpio pads trailer to 512 bytes, do we want that? */
return EXIT_SUCCESS;
}
free(line);
} /* end of "while (1)" */
}
#endif
